На данный вопрос уже ответили:
Есть строка типа:
CN=БУЛАТОВА ЖАНАР,SURNAME=БУЛАТОВА,SERIALNUMBER=IIN589658742568,
C=KZ,L=АЛМАТЫ,S=АЛМАТЫ ОБЛЫСЫ,O="ҚАЛА ШАРУАШЫЛЫҒЫ БАСҚАРМАСЫ" МЕМЛЕКЕТТІК МЕКЕМЕСІ,OU=BIN963258786458,G=БЕРІКҚЫЗЫ,E=zhanar_93@MAIL.RU
Нужно искать слово CN
или (S, L, CITY, SERIALNUMBER
). Если есть такое слово, то сразу отрезать это слово до запятой, то есть SERIALNUMBER=IIN589658742568
Как можно сделать это попроще на одной или не более двух строк?
Все эти 3 метода делают то, что тебе нужно. Выбирай любой.
let str = 'CN=БУЛАТОВА ЖАНАР,SURNAME=БУЛАТОВА,SERIALNUMBER=IIN589658742568, C=KZ,L=АЛМАТЫ,S=АЛМАТЫ ОБЛЫСЫ,O="ҚАЛА ШАРУАШЫЛЫҒЫ БАСҚАРМАСЫ" МЕМЛЕКЕТТІК МЕКЕМЕСІ,OU=BIN963258786458,G=БЕРІКҚЫЗЫ,E=zhanar_93@MAIL.RU';
console.log(str.split(",")[0]);
console.log(str.replace(/,.*/g, ""));
console.log(str.match(/(.*?),/)[1]);
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
День добрыйМожет ли мне кто-нибудь подсказать, как протестировать асинхронный action в хранилище?
Имеется текстовое поле, в которое вводится значение, по которому фильтруется store, тк